How do Mycotoxins affect the nervous system?

Mycotoxins may act on the size and morphological properties of intestinal nervous structures and the neurochemical character of the enteric neurons. These changes are probably a result of adaptive and protective reactions, which affect homeostasis maintenance.

Can mold exposure cause dysautonomia?

In regard to toxicity that may cause dysautonomia, a variety of toxins can be the cause. These may include toxins from mold, heavy metal exposure, alcoholism, vitamin and mineral deficiencies, and drugs, such as those from chemotherapy.

How does mold affect nervous system?

Inflammation: Mold spores act as irritants, which can trigger the body to mount an immune response. This can lead to inflammation throughout the body. Inflammation in the brain can impair cognitive function, and in the case of chronic inflammation, this can lead to long-lasting cognitive impairment.

Does mold cause autism?

The information reviewed indicates that exposure to mold and mycotoxins can affect the nervous system, directly or through immune cell activation, thus contributing to neurodevelopmental disorders such as autism spectrum disorder.

Can mold cause neurological symptoms?

Some of the neurologic symptoms of toxic mold include weakness, light sensitivity, sinus problems, blurred vision, concentration and memory issues, tremors and a general feeling of numbness.

Can mold cause Hashimoto’s?

In a 2015 survey of 2232 people who had Hashimoto’s, 20% reported that their health declined after a move (1), possibly indicating a new mold exposure or other environmental toxin exposure. Additionally, we know that if a person is immunosuppressed, we need to be on the lookout for toxic mold.

Can mold cause MS like symptoms?

Mold as a Cause of Multiple Sclerosis Mycotoxins cross the blood-brain barrier and directly damage nerve cells. The damaged cells release debris that triggers an immune response creating more oxidative damage. The mycotoxin gliotoxin has been shown to cause nerve cell death and demyelination in research studies.
